What is the cheapest time of day to fly to Israel?

The average price for all round-trip flights from Dublin to Israel depending on the time of departure, clicked by users on KAYAK in the last 2 weeks.
The cheapest time of day to fly to Israel is generally in the evening, when retur flights cost £307 on average. Morning departures are around 8% more expensive than evening flights, on average. The most expensive time of day to fly to Israel is generally in the morning, which is peak travel time and where the average cost of a ticket is £331.

What is the cheapest month to fly from Dublin to Israel?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Dublin to Israel,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.
The cheapest month for flights from Dublin to Israel is January, when tickets cost £195 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are May and July, when the average cost of return tickets is £427 and £392 respectively.

What’s the cheapest day of the week to fly from Dublin to Israel?

The average price of all round-trip flights from Dublin to Israel clicked on KAYAK for each day over the last 12 months.
Your flight ticket price will generally be cheaper if you fly to Israel on a Saturday and more expensive on a Thursday. On your return trip to Dublin, you should consider flying back on a Saturday, and avoid Wednesdays for better deals.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Dublin to Israel?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ights from Dublin to Israel,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.
To get a below-average price on the flight from Dublin to Israel, you should book around 8 weeks before departure.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 24 weeks before departure.

  • What is the Hacker Fare option on flights from Dublin to Israel?

    Hacker Fares allow you to combine one-way tickets in order to save you money over a traditional return ticket. You could then fly from Dublin to Israel with an airline and back with another airline.
